TO-MORROW'S RUGBY

The main attraction in the Rugby football matches to be played on the Gisborne Oval to-morrow will be the Hastings v. Gisborne High Schools’ game. The Hastings High cchool 'team is as follows:—McGavock, , captain, Rixin, vicecaptain, Cnssin, Goodman, Lowe, Doole, liny. Reeves, Herries, Richmond, Harding. McNab, Chook, Wedd and King; emergencies, Ogg, Ferguson and Wilson. The draw for the games is as, follows: Hastings High School v. Gisbonie High School. No. 1 ground, 2.45 p.m., referee Mr. H. Hunter. B Division.—High School Old Boys v. Old Boys, No. 1 ground, 1.30 p.m., referee. Mr. G. A. Gladding; Marist v. A.T.C., No. 2 ground, 1.30 p.m., Mr. T. J. Leslie. Touch Judges.—No. 1 ground, 1.30 p.m.. Captain N. G. Pauling and Mr. I. N. Charles: No. 1 ground, 2.45 p.m., Messrs. K. R. Waite and A. E. Ingram.
